FOREVER 21, is a Californian fast fashion retailer. Shown is shop in Oxford Street, London.


Size: 5540px × 3693px
Location: Oxford Street, London, England, UK
Photo credit: © UrbanImages /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: .., 21, branch, branches, britain, british, building, buildings, central, clothes, clothing, england, english, entrance, fashion, fashions, fast, female, front, frontage, gb, great, horizontal, isles, kingdom, london, male, mens, oxford, premises, properties, property, retailer, retailers, seller, sellers, shop, shops, showroom, showrooms, store, stores, street, uk, united, west, womens